Texto de la carta

Daña primero. Siempre que la Ogresa avivabatallas ataque, puedes lanzar la carta de instantáneo o de conjuro objetivo desde tu cementerio pagando {R}{R} además de sus otros costes. Si ese hechizo fuera a ir a un cementerio, en vez de eso, exílialo. Cuando lances ese hechizo, la Ogresa avivabatallas obtiene +X/+0 hasta el final del turno, donde X es el valor de maná de ese hechizo.
